Where can I donate umbilical cord stem cells?

0

NIH cannot accept donated umbilical cord stem cells from the general public. The National Marrow Donor Program maintains a Web page on donating cord blood at http://www.marrow.org/HELP/Donate_Cord_Blood_Share_Life/index.html, and the International Cord Blood Society has one at http://www.cordblood.org/index.php?rm=common_page&id=10.
